Background
Animal husbandry is a production department for obtaining animal products such as meat, eggs, milk, wool, cashmere, skin, silk and medicinal materials by utilizing the physiological functions of animals such as livestock and poultry which are domesticated by human beings or wild animals such as deer, musk, fox, mink, otter and quail and converting pasture, feed and other plant energy into animal energy through artificial feeding and breeding. Is different from self-sufficient livestock breeding, and is mainly characterized by centralization, scale production and profit-making production purposes. The animal husbandry is an extremely important link for exchanging substances between human beings and the nature, and the forage grass is needed to be fed in the animal husbandry, and the harvested forage grass needs to be crushed in the feeding process to achieve the purpose of the best feeding effect.

Referring to fig. 1-4, a pasture grass pulverizer for livestock breeding comprises a base 1, wherein the base 1 is movably connected with a placing box 21 through a placing groove, a handle 4 is fixedly arranged at the middle end of the right side of the placing box 21, supporting legs 22 are fixedly arranged on the periphery of the bottom of the placing box 21, the bottoms of the supporting legs 22 are movably connected with moving wheels 23 through rotating shafts, the transportation problem of the processed pasture grass can be effectively solved, L-shaped plates 24 are fixedly connected to the two sides of the top of the base 1, a box body 3 is fixedly connected to the outer surface of the top of the L-shaped plates 24, a feeding port 11 is fixedly arranged at the top of the box body 3, a discharging port 2 is fixedly arranged at the bottom of the box body 3, a transverse plate 14 is fixedly arranged on the inner wall of the box body 3, a plurality of through holes 15 are formed in the inner, baffles 16 are fixedly arranged on two sides of the bottom of the box body 3, processed forage grass can effectively slide to a placing box 21 from a discharge port 2, a motor 6 is fixedly arranged on the top of an L-shaped plate 24 on one side, a first rotating shaft 7 is fixedly connected with the output end of the motor 6 and can crush the forage grass, a first belt pulley 5 is fixedly arranged on the outer surface of the right side of the first rotating shaft 7, a second rotating shaft 9 is movably connected to the right side of the top of an inner cavity of the box body 3 through a bearing, a first rolling rod 12 is fixedly connected to the outer surface of the second rotating shaft 9, a second belt pulley 10 is fixedly connected to the outer part of the box body 3 after the right side of the second rotating shaft 9 penetrates through the inner cavity of the box body 3, a belt 8 is sleeved on the surfaces of the first belt pulley 5 and the second belt pulley 10, the first belt pulley 5 and the second belt pulley 10 are in, inner chamber swing joint of sliding tray 18 has sliding plate 17, sliding plate 17's inner wall fixed mounting has dead lever 20, the surface swing joint of dead lever 20 has the second to grind depression bar 25, the equal fixed mounting in both sides of sliding plate 17 dorsal part has electric telescopic handle 19, the inner wall fixed connection of electric telescopic handle 19 opposite side and box 3, the advantage of smashing a large amount of forage grass has been reached, there is first pivot 7 in the left side of box 3 inner chamber through bearing swing joint, the surface fixed connection of first pivot 7 has blade 13, the right side of first pivot 7 runs through the inner chamber of box 3 and extends to the outside of box 3.
When the forage grass crushing device is used, people pour forage grass into the box body 3 through the feed port 11, the motor 6 is started through the external controller, the motor 6 drives the first rotating shaft 7 to rotate, the first rotating shaft 7 drives the first belt pulley 5 to rotate while rotating, the first belt pulley 5 drives the second belt pulley 10 to rotate while rotating through the belt 8, the second belt pulley 10 drives the second rotating shaft 9 to rotate while rotating, the second rotating shaft 9 drives the first crushing rod 12 to rotate while rotating, the poured forage grass is crushed, the electric telescopic rod 19 is controlled to stretch through the external controller, the electric telescopic rod 19 drives the second crushing rod 25 to move while stretching, so that the purpose of adjusting the crushing distance is achieved, the requirements of different forage grass on crushing are met, the crushed forage grass drops to the bottom of the inner cavity of the box body 3, the motor 6 drives the first rotating shaft 7 to rotate, outer fixed surface of first pivot 7 is connected with blade 13 to begin to smash the forage grass, treat that the forage grass is smashed and accomplish the back, fall into through-hole 15 through discharge gate 2 and place the case 21 in, will place case 21 through pulling handle 4 and from left to right translate and take out, transport relevant position (external controller is the PLC controller in this application, simultaneously, two wiring ends of external controller are connected with power plug through the wire, just adopt the commercial power to supply power in this application).
